1How does Dovray's climate affect my choice of flooring material?

Dovray's significant temperature swings and humidity changes between seasons demand dimensionally stable flooring. Engineered hardwood, luxury vinyl plank (LVP), and tile are excellent choices as they resist expansion and contraction better than solid hardwood in our climate. Proper acclimation of materials inside your home for 48-72 hours before installation is a non-negotiable step for any installer to prevent future gaps or buckling.

5What are common hidden costs I should budget for in a Dovray flooring project?

Beyond material and labor, common additional costs include subfloor repair (common in older homes), furniture moving and disposal of old flooring, and potential transitions or moldings specific to your layout. For homes with basements or ground-level slabs, a moisture barrier is often a necessary add-on to prevent moisture wicking from the soil, which is a key consideration given our freeze-thaw cycles and spring melt.
